Data suggests that millions of bats die each year at wind energy facilities; Scientists calculated bat deaths by picking up carcasses under turbines. While data shows nearly 1 million bats per year are killed, researchers do not know the exact cumulative global biodiversity toll of wind energy since many areas where the technology is growing quickly — including areas with high bat diversity, like the tropics — have significant data gaps in terms of knowing what bat species are. It’s estimated that tens to hundreds of thousands die at wind turbines each year in north america alone. Unfortunately, it’s not yet clear. Studies show bat fatalities in central europe average 14.3 bats per turbine (ranging from 1.5 to 30 bats per turbine).
